Abstract: 目的考察以β-环糊精(β-CD)为键合固定相的色谱柱分离纯化银杏叶提取物和银杏黄酮的影响因素.方法以色谱图中色谱峰的个数和目标物为离度为指标,采用低压液相色谱技术对银杏叶提取物和银杏黄酮进行分离纯化.同时比较固定相、流动相、缓冲液、pH值、洗脱速度和上样体积对分离结果的影响.结果氯代环氧丙烷偶联β-CD-Superose 12 pg键合相能够较好地分离银杏叶提取物和银杏黄酮,优于葡聚糖凝胶Sephardex LH-20.结论β-环糊精键合固定相适用于银杏叶提取物和银杏黄酮的分离与纯化.
